Meeting notes — Plugin Authors Forum, Driftbay Platform

We reviewed the container image slimming initiative for the Driftbay plugin runtime. Starting next quarter, plugin images must build from the slimmed Kestrelbase layers; anything bundling a full OS userland will fail the registry gate. Authors should test against the preview base now and report incompatibilities, particularly around native dependencies. Migration guides and a compatibility matrix are in the shared wiki. Questions on exemptions go to the maintainer named below.

named custodian: Oliath Ralax

TICKET: Config drift — build agent clock skew

Agents in the Harkfield pool drifted up to 40s apart; NTP settings diverged after last month's image rebuild. Result: flaky cache invalidation and signed-artifact timestamp failures on Pellwright CI. Drift only affects agents imaged before the rebuild. Fix: reapply the baseline time-sync config and restart chronyd. The expected baseline configuration values are below.

service settings:
[casax]
port = 6379
team = rusir
host = casax.zemvarhq.corp
region = outer-4
access_code = ac_9808ce
timeout_ms = 1500

**New starter — Day 1: badge migration (Orvex system)**

Facilities desk: old Kestrel-format badges stop working Friday. All new starters get Orvex cards only. Verify photo on file, print card, test on Door 3 (still on legacy reader — known issue, log failures). Do NOT issue paper day-passes; the cohort after migration must be fully carded. Collect any legacy badges handed in and bin them in the shredder tray. If the Orvex printer jams, use the backup enrolment code below.

staff pass of kawip-hawef = bdg-QLP-2